Jason Wood is an Adjunct Professor of Accounting at State University of New York (SUNY), College at Geneseo. Board Member, Auckland Chapter of ISACA. Jason has been practicing public accounting for over 20 years and owns a Certified Public Accounting firm in New York State, and a Chartered Accountancy Firm in Auckland New Zealand. Jason is a Certified Public Accountant (New York and Texas); Chartered Accountant (New Zealand); Certified Information Systems Auditor; Certified Internal Auditor; Certified Information Technology Professional; and Certified in Financial Forensics. He has previously published with John Wiley & Sons Inc. with IT Auditing and Application Controls (Wood, Brown, Howe) and with the American Accounting Association with Business in the Cloud: Research Questions on Governance, Audit, and Assurance (Schmidt, Wood, Grabski).

Education:
MBA, Information Assurance, University of Dallas
B.B.A., Accounting, Southern Methodist University
